My Nonprofit Reviews

beeswax
43 profile views
1 reviews
Review for Feed Foundation Inc, New York, NY, USA
Every day I get multiple phone calls from this group. STOP CALLING ME. They use a bunch of different numbers but all are registered to them
Had to click a role. NOT A DONOR
Role: Donor